Holiday Inn Express & Suites - St. Petersburg - Madeira Beach, an IHG Hotel 2.5 km from Saint Pete Beach
Hotel in Saint Petersburg FL
8.7
Very Good
From $162
From $162
Info Categories
Hotel for Honeymoon


3-Star Hotel


Hotel with Spa


Show more
 
Peninsula Bed & Cocktails 5.5 km from Saint Pete Beach
Hotel in Saint Petersburg FL
8.8
Excellent
From $147
From $147
Info Categories
Hotel for Honeymoon


3-Star Hotel


Dog Friendly Hotel

Dog Play Area  

Dog Play Area  


Show more
 
Sunburst Inn- Indian Shores Beach 5.7 km from Saint Pete Beach
Hotel in Clearwater Beach FL
9.1
Excellent
From $373
From $373
Info Categories
3-Star Hotel

Hotel for Honeymoon

Beachfront Hotel


Show more
 
Legacy Vacation Resorts-Indian Shores 6.4 km from Saint Pete Beach
Resort in Clearwater Beach FL
9.3
Excellent
From $236
From $236
Info Categories
Resort for Honeymoon


3-Star Resort


Resort near Golf Courses


Show more
 
Holiday Inn - St. Petersburg West, an IHG Hotel 6.4 km from Saint Pete Beach
Hotel in Saint Petersburg FL
7.6
Good
From $125
From $125
Info Categories
Hotel for Honeymoon


3-Star Hotel


Family Friendly Hotel


Show more
 
Lover's Nest/Rand Motel 6.9 km from Saint Pete Beach
Hotel in Saint Petersburg FL
8.1
Very Good
Info Categories
Hotel for Honeymoon


3-Star Hotel


Hotel with Free Wi-Fi


Show more
 
Residence Inn St. Petersburg Tierra Verde 7.3 km from Saint Pete Beach
Hotel in Tierra Verde FL
9.1
Excellent
Info Categories
Hotel for Honeymoon


3-Star Hotel


Family Friendly Hotel


Show more
 
La Quinta Inn by Wyndham Tampa Bay Pinellas Park Clearwater 7.4 km from Saint Pete Beach
Hotel in Pinellas Park FL
4.5
Rated
From $75
From $75
Info Categories
Hotel for Honeymoon


3-Star Hotel


Family Friendly Hotel


Show more
 
Country Inn & Suites by Radisson, St Petersburg - Clearwater, FL 7.4 km from Saint Pete Beach
Hotel in Pinellas Park FL
7.1
Good
From $116
From $116
Info Categories
Hotel for Honeymoon


3-Star Hotel


Hotel with Parking

EV charging stations  


Show more
 
Fairfield Inn & Suites by Marriott St Petersburg North 7.7 km from Saint Pete Beach
Hotel in Saint Petersburg FL
8.4
Very Good
From $123
From $123
Info Categories
Hotel for Honeymoon


3-Star Hotel


Hotel Taking Steps Towards Sustainability


Show more
 
La Quinta by Wyndham Clearwater South 7.8 km from Saint Pete Beach
Hotel in Clearwater FL
8.0
Very Good
From $128
From $128
Info Categories
Hotel for Honeymoon


3-Star Hotel


Family Friendly Hotel


Show more
 
Comfort Inn St Petersburg North 7.9 km from Saint Pete Beach
Hotel in Saint Petersburg FL
7.3
Good
From $106
From $106
Info Categories
Hotel for Honeymoon


3-Star Hotel


Hotel with Swimming Pool

Outdoor Pool  


Show more
 
Home2 Suites By Hilton Largo, Fl 8.0 km from Saint Pete Beach
Hotel in Largo FL
9.2
Excellent
Info Categories
Hotel for Honeymoon


3-Star Hotel


Hotel Taking Steps Towards Sustainability


Show more
 
Splash Harbor Water Park Resort 8.0 km from Saint Pete Beach
Hotel in Clearwater Beach FL
Info Categories
Hotel for Honeymoon


3-Star Hotel


Hotel near Golf Courses


Show more
 
Holiday Inn & Suites Clearwater Beach S-Harbourside 8.1 km from Saint Pete Beach
Resort in Clearwater Beach FL
7.2
Good
From $209
From $209
Info Categories
Resort for Honeymoon


3-Star Resort


Resort near Golf Courses


Show more
 
Hollander Hotel - Downtown St. Petersburg 9.0 km from Saint Pete Beach
Hotel in Saint Petersburg FL
9.0
Excellent
From $115
From $115
Info Categories
Hotel for Honeymoon


3-Star Hotel


Hotel with Spa


Show more
 
Courtyard by Marriott St. Petersburg Downtown 9.0 km from Saint Pete Beach
Hotel in Saint Petersburg FL
7.3
Good
From $179
From $179
Info Categories
Hotel for Honeymoon


3-Star Hotel


Hotel Taking Steps Towards Sustainability


Show more
 
The Exchange Hotel 9.1 km from Saint Pete Beach
Hotel in Saint Petersburg FL
7.5
Good
Info Categories
Hotel for Honeymoon


3-Star Hotel


Hotel with Swimming Pool

Outdoor Pool  


Show more
 
Hyatt Place St. Petersburg/Downtown 9.2 km from Saint Pete Beach
Hotel in Saint Petersburg FL
8.7
Very Good
From $213
From $213
Info Categories
Hotel for Honeymoon


3-Star Hotel


Hotel with Parking

EV charging stations  


Show more
 
Hilton St. Petersburg Bayfront 9.3 km from Saint Pete Beach
Hotel in Saint Petersburg FL
7.1
Good
From $214
From $214
Info Categories
Hotel for Honeymoon


3-Star Hotel


Hotel Taking Steps Towards Sustainability


Show more
 
*Additional taxes or fees may apply. Please check the final price before completing your booking.
Categories:
  •     3 Star (108)
  •     Honeymoon (108)
  •     Pool (95)
  •     Outdoor Pool (93)
  •     Business (89)
  •     Gym (79)
  •     Parking (76)
  •     Family (75)
  •     Accessible (65)
  •     Dog Friendly (61)
  •     Heated Pool (41)
  •     Beach (39)
  •     Sustainability Journey (38)
  •     Golf (30)
  •     Nightlife (27)
  •     Beachfront (17)
  •     Free Wi-Fi (14)
  •     EV charging stations (11)
  •     Small (9)
  •     Spa (5)
  •     Tennis (2)
  •     Children's Pool (2)
  •     Indoor Pool (2)
  •     Haunted (1)
  •     Pool Lap Lanes (1)
  •     Rooms with Jacuzzi / Hot-Tub (1)
  •     Adult Only (1)
  •     Dog Play Area (1)
  •     Yoga (1)
×
Checkin
×
Categories
2
Map
× Home About Press Categories Blog Hotel Awards Travelmyth GPT Contact Terms & Conditions Privacy Policy Cookies Policy FAQ